Vikrant says 'Mirzapur' had 85 percent men indulging testosterones, male egos

Mirzapur's transition to the big screen this September brings back fan favorites, though Vikrant Massey's absence as Bablu Pandit is noted, with Jitendra Kumar stepping in. Massey fondly recalled the show's unexpected success, admitting he wished his character's journey hadn't ended so soon. He shared how the series, initially a collaborative effort, quickly became a cultural phenomenon, with Bablu becoming a household name overnight after its release.
